#00198d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#00198d is composed of 0% red, 9.8% green and 55.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 100% cyan, 82.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 44.7% black. It has a hue angle of 229.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 27.6%. #00198d color hex could be obtained by blending #0032ff with #00001b. Closest websafe color is: #000099.

Shades and Tints of #00198d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000104 is the darkest color, while #eff2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#00198d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#41434c is the less saturated color, while #00198d is the most saturated one.
